IT04813: WEBSPHERE MQ 7.5 MFT PROTOCOL BRIDGE AGENT INTERMITTENTLY GETTING BFGIO0106E ERRORS

Error description

  • A WebSphere MQ 7.5 Managed File Transfer transfer setup to
    transfer files
    from protocol bridge agent with the following source
    specification:
    
    
     Server:/dir1/dir2/*.file
    
    
    is intermittently getting BFGIO0106E errors while trying to
    incorrectly process Server:/dir1/dir2 as a file transfer.
    
    Example error:
    BFGIO0106E:
    File "Server:/dir1/dir2" is not a normal file (it might be
    a directory).;

Problem summary

  • ****************************************************************
    USERS AFFECTED:
    This APAR affects all users of WebSphere MQ Managed File
    Transfer who use a protocol bridge agent as the source of files
    for a file transfer. If particular it affects users who use a
    wild-card when specifying the names of the source files to be
    transferred.
    
    
    Platforms affected:
    MultiPlatform
    
    ****************************************************************
    PROBLEM DESCRIPTION:
    The problem occurred when attempting to generate a list of file
    names to be processed.
    
    The protocol bridge agent needed to connect to a remote ftp/sftp
    server to obtain a list of file names that matched a wild-card
    specification. The agent was unable to make the connection and
    an exception was generated. The processing of this exception was
    handled internally but the action taken allowed the processing
    of the transfer to continue processing with an empty list of
    file names. This subsequently caused the creation of the error
    message "BFGIO0106E:
    File "Server:/dir1/dir2" is not a normal file (it might be
    a directory)".
    

Problem conclusion

  • The WebSphere MQ Managed File Transfer product code has been
    modified such that when a connection to a remote ftp/sftp server
    fails the original exception generated by this failure is now
    returned and this will cause the transfer to fail.

    The fix is targeted for delivery in the following PTFs:
    
    Version    Maintenance Level
    v7.0       7.0.4.5
    v7.5       7.5.0.5
    v8.0       8.0.0.2
